Course programme
This course is if you are interested in business and, in
particular, in how businesses work and how employees help to make
businesses successful.
What will I study?
This course will allow you to study for the Award in year one
and also prepare units for progression to the Diploma in year two.
Subjects covered include business and management, creative product
promotion, business enterprise, business ethics and European
business operations.
Subjects:
- Business and Management
- Business Enterprise
- Business Online
- Creative Product Promotion
- Introduction to Business
- Presenting Business Information
- Business Ethics
- European Business Operations
- Finance Cash Flow and Insolvency
- Improving Performance in the Workplace
- Introduction to Marketing
- Managing a Business Project or Event
- Managing Teams

What are the entry requirements?
You will need to come to the college for an interview and may be
asked to complete a short test. You should have achieved the
following - 5 A-C grades in GCSE of which English MUST be one.
Please do not be put off as, depending upon your experience, there
may be some flexibility over entry requirements.
